install OEM parking sensors to w211
 
hello
is it difficult to install from scratch the OEM parking sensor system ??
does it have wiring if it is not installed from beginning ??
thanks

kjb55 02-28-2017 10:55 AM

I did the rear OEM install on a W203. It was involved to say the least and I had the help of SteveNL at the time. Bumper removal, ECU install, wiring, replacing rear headliner light with integrated indicator / light, etc.

I'm not even tempted to do it in my W211. If you are - I'd go with the Bosch URF7 system. It's essentially the OEM parts less the OEM display.
